    DESCRIPTION

    Soft Salmon Saucer is an early-blooming herbaceous peony known for its large, luminous single blooms and distinctive coloring. The flowers feature wide, rounded petals in warm peach-salmon tones that form a broad “saucer” shape around a golden-yellow center of prominent stamens. Each bloom measures up to 8 inches across, creating a bold yet elegant focal point in the spring garden.

    Plants reach 28 to 32 inches tall with a tidy, upright habit and deep green foliage that remains attractive through summer. Stems are strong enough to support the large blooms with minimal staking. A good choice for both landscape use and cut flower arrangements, Soft Salmon Saucer adds a soft but eye-catching presence to borders, cottage gardens, and peony collections.

    FALL PLANTING INSTRUCTIONS

    1.  Dig a hole about 12" wide and 12" deep.

    2.  Create a mound of soil in the center of the hole.

    3.  Position the root so that the eyes (buds) face upward and are 1–2 inches below the soil surface (no deeper!).

    4.  Backfill gently, firming soil around the root.

    5.  Water thoroughly.

    This Plant's Growing Zones: 3 - 8
    What's my zone?
    Botanical Name:
    Paeonia lactiflora × ‘Soft Salmon Saucer’
    Plant Type:
    Perennial
    Light Requirements:
    Full sun to part shade
    Mature Height:
    28-32 in.
    Mature Spread:
    28-30 in.
    Blooms:
    Early season (very early spring)
    Characteristics:
    Elegant single saucer‑shaped blooms in soft pink to salmon with golden centers; strong upright stems and firm foliage; excellent for cut flowers; early blooming; refined and subtle garden presence
